There are 3rd party loan administration companies that will also "professionalize" the loan transaction, and give the lender more peace of mind.Many advise, for the security of the lender, that you execute a couple of additional documents: (1) document permitting the lender to deed the property to themselves if you are more than xx days late on the payment (often 30 days), and (2) an assignment of rents, allowing the lender to intercede with the tenants and begin collecting the rent directly if you are more than xx days late on the payment (again, 30 days is common).
